🎉 Welcome to Zeru Cheng’s Academic Website! 🎉

Hello! I’m a 3rd year Software Engineering undergrad at Nanjing University. I’m also a member of the DevOps+ Research Laboratory, with privilege of working closely with Jinwei Xu, Yanjing Yang and under the guidance of research assistant Lanxin Yang. My research interests lie in Software Security Assurance, Large language Models (LLMs), Natural Language Processing (NLP) and Computer Vision (CV).

📖 Education

Nanjing University Logo

Nanjing University

2023.09 - 2027.07 (Expected)

B.E. in Software Engineering

GPA: 92.0/100 (4.60/5.00)

🔥 News

📝 Publications

FlexPainter Preview
TOSEM

One Size Does Not Fit All: Investigating Efficacy of Perplexity in Detecting LLM-Generated Code

Jinwei Xu, He Zhang, Yanjing Yang, Lanxin Yang, Zeru Cheng, Jun Lyu, Bohan Liu, Xin Zhou, Alberto Bacchelli, Yin Kia Chiam, Thiam Kian Chiew

📚 Projects

Riverside Scene at Qingming Festival

This is my entry for Nanjing University EL Programming Design Competition. It integrates AI technology into traditional cultural works, exploring novel ways of disseminating traditional culture. Due to the fact that it is still in the review stage, the code cannot be made public at present.
Unity OpenAI API

"Ma Lan on Cloud" Education Platform

This is our entry for the Challenge Cup competition. This platform integrates sections such as travel maps, 3D digital exhibition halls, platform courses, question-and-answer systems, and audio-visual resources. It will provide users with a one-stop channel for learning digital ideological and political knowledge. Due to the fact that it is still in the review stage, the code cannot be made public at present.
Vue.js RESTful API Echarts Flask

"Tomato" Bookstore Website

An online bookstore platform with user-friendly interface and comprehensive book management system.
Vue.js RESTful API Spring Boot MySQL

FxNexus

The entry for the Citibank Cup, a set of foreign exchange data dashboards, was created using the TradingView library to customize some data display components.
Vue.js TradingView JavaScript HTML/CSS Data Visualization

API Shield

A detection system for API abnormal traffic, including a complete set of tools for the entire process of traffic scanning, identification and analysis. Due to the fact that it is still in the review stage, the code cannot be made public at present.
Vue.js Python API Security Machine Learning Data Analysis

🏅 Honors and Awards

  • Nantional Scholarship, 2024
    Top 0.2% nationwide, the highest honor for undergraduates in China, ¥10,000
    NJU | 2024

  • BYD Scholarship, 2024
    The social scholarship donated by BYD Company, ¥10,000
    NJU | 2025

  • Meritorious Winner
    2025   The Mathematical Contest in Modeling
    America | 2025

  • First Prize
    2024   Nanjing University EL Programming Design Competition
    Nanjing, China | 2024

  • Second Prize
    2025   National University Biotechnology Internet of Things Design Regional Competition
    Hangzhou, China | 2025

  • Third Prize
    2024   National Student Software Innovation Regional Competition
    Nanjing, China | 2024

  • Outstanding Student Leader,2023,2024